An apology to my patients


Elaine Ritchie


As a healthcare professional I feel ashamed to say that I wasn’t aware of childlessness until I was in that position myself and my grief hit me.

I have held patient’s hands while they are having procedures and asked the “do you have children?” question. I thought I was helping to take their mind off what was being done to them. I didn’t know I was asking a dreaded question at such a vulnerable time.

To all those childless patients that I clumsily asked that question, I am so so sorry. I see you and your pain.
